def test_name_already_exists(self) -> None: """Test exception on source `name` already exists.""" with pytest.raises(IntegrityError): Source.add({ 'type_id': 1, 'facility_id': None, 'user_id': 1, 'name': 'refitt', 'description': '...', 'data': {} })
def test_embedded(self) -> None: """Test embedded method to check JSON-serialization and auto-join.""" assert Source.from_name('antares').to_json(join=True) == { 'id': 2, 'type_id': 3, 'facility_id': None, 'user_id': None, 'name': 'antares', 'description': 'Antares is an alert broker developed by NOAO for ZTF and LSST.', 'data': {}, 'type': { 'id': 3, 'name': 'broker', 'description': 'Alerts from data brokers.' } }
def test_name_missing(self) -> None: """Test exception on missing source `name`.""" with pytest.raises(NotFound): Source.from_name('Missing Source Name')
def test_from_name(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Test loading source from `name`.""" for record in testdata['source']: assert Source.from_name(record['name']).name == record['name']
def test_id_missing(self) -> None: """Test exception on missing source `id`.""" with pytest.raises(NotFound): Source.from_id(-1)
def test_from_id(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Test loading source from `id`.""" # NOTE: `id` not set until after insert for i, record in enumerate(testdata['source']): assert Source.from_id(i + 1).name == record['name']
def test_embedded_no_join(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Tests embedded method to check JSON-serialization.""" for data in testdata['source']: assert data == json_roundtrip(Source(**data).to_json(join=False))
def test_tuple(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Test tuple-conversion.""" for data in testdata['source']: source = Source.from_dict(data) assert tuple(data.values()) == source.to_tuple()
def test_dict(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Test round-trip of dict translations.""" for data in testdata['source']: source = Source.from_dict(data) assert data == source.to_dict()
def test_init(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Create source instance and validate accessors.""" for data in testdata['source']: source = Source(**data) for key, value in data.items(): assert getattr(source, key) == value
def test_relationship_source_type(self, testdata: TestData) -> None: """Test source foreign key relationship on source_type.""" for i, record in enumerate(testdata['source']): assert Source.from_id(i + 1).type.id == record['type_id']
